Here it
is short and sweet, I had actually been looking for a Lethal White aka mxm pup (she’s my
first). On a blog I’ve been on for awhile
there it was, the urgent message partial
blind/deaf Aussie Shepherd only 3 days until PTS she was only 6 months old.
I contacted the St. Martinsville Parrish AC officer, they are VERY rescue
friendly there in Louisiana. They found her tied to their doorknob one morning. The
shelter was full and they had to make some gut wrenching decisions and she
was their decision. I called them and told them I would be positively be there to pick her up on Saturday Oct.17,
2009 because that Saturday was AFTER her death date It was critical they
knew I was serious and would be there.
I brought her home, October will be a year she’s been with me.
Her vision in her left eye is good enough to see hand signs she has no
hearing though sometimes I swear she can hear and sometimes better than my
hearing pups! She is so smart & has learned signing such as out, potty
walk, play, goodnight, bye, sit, down, treat, water, good girl, we are
working on stay and no! I have a feeling those may take some time lol! She is so sweet, loving and has such a wonderful
personality I am in love with her! Hope Livz has
gained her weight and is thriving and such a wonderful addition to my
family, I have decided I will always have at least one lethal in my pack!
We have been
invited to help other humans at our local PetSmart
with their deaf pups. And we have been asked to go to Texas A&M to speak to a group of kids considering going
there for their DVM studies. Everywhere we go, she gets noticed and I know
she will help educate others on the plight of the Lethal White and help
save many pups. I am so proud of her. Thank you for letting me share her story.
